Nabati Cheese Wafer’s Ingredients

Nabati cheese wafer is made of two major parts, cream and wafer sheet.They are then combined to form the cheese wafer. It is good to know that ingredients are already split and mentioned on the pack. It’s pretty easy for me. Eeee.
Firstly, let me brief you about the ingredients used for production of cream, followed by the ingredients required for production of wafer sheet.

Cream

The cream contains about 59 % of cheese wafer. The following ingredients are used to make the cream.

Nabati Wafer ingredients 3

Source : Sugarcane
How : From sugarcane, the juice is extracted. Then the juice is heated, filtered and purified. Then it is crystallized to produce sugar.
Why : The first ingredient used in making cream is sugar.  Its ultimate role is to provide sweetness. It also gives the texture to the cream as it is used in a higher amount in the cream.

  • Palm Olein

Source : Palm fruit
How : Edible Vegetable Oil (Palm Olein) is obtained by extracting palm oil from reddish pulp of a palm fruit. The palm oil contains fifty percent saturated and fifty percent unsaturated fat content. The unsaturated fat is separated using fractional distillation method to produce palm olein oil. It is liquid at room temperature.
Why : This edible vegetable oil gives the velvetty nature to the cream. It improves the texture of the cream and also gives a glossy effect to the cream.

Cheese powder is made up of multiple ingredients.  Cheese powder gives cheese flavour and texture to the cream. Let us now look up about the multiple ingredients used for making the cheese powder.

  • Sugar

Source : Sugarcane
How : From sugarcane, the juice is extracted. Then the juice is heated, filtered and purified. Then it is crystallized to produce sugar.
Why : Sugar is also the base ingredient for the production of cheese powder. This provides  taste and texture.

  •  Cheese Solids

Source : Hard Cheese
How : Hard cheese is first melted and then emulsions are added to keep the mixture stable. Then it is spray dried to produce cheese solids by evaporating water content from it.
Why : Cheese solids are just the powdered form of cheese. It is added here to give the cheese flavour and taste. Milk cheese is used for production.

  • Maltodextrin

Source : Corn
How :  Maltodextrin  is produced by enzymatic hydrolysis of corn.
Why :  Maltodextrins mostly  act as  filler agents, it also acts as a carrier which holds the colour added in it. It also provides sweetness. These are added to impart colour to the cream, enhance the visual appearance of the product and also to give better mouthfeel to the consumer.

Source : Milk
How : The water content in the milk is evaporated to produce milk solids or milk powder. The milk solids contain protein, lactose and fat which are the remaining contents after evaporation of the water content from milk.
Why : Milk powder gives richness, flavour and good texture to the cream.

Source : Corn Grain
How : Corn grain is divided into four main parts by a wet milling process. They are germ, gluten, starch and fiber. Starch is separated from this and it is ground to powder form called corn starch.
Why : Corn starch adds bulkiness to the cream by acting as a thickener and also provides the improved consistency of the cream.

  • INS 322

Name : Soy Lecithin
Source : Soy beans
How : Soy beans are used to produce soybean oil. During this production, soy lecithin is obtained as a by-product of soybean oil production.
Why : Soy lecithin is an emulsifier, it is added to hold ingredients together which cannot be mixed together easily.

  • INS 330

Name : Citric Acid
Source : Molasses
How : Citric acid is produced by fermentation of molasses by aspergillus niger. Molasses is sourced from sugarcane.
Why : The citric acid acts as an acidity regulator and maintains the pH of the cream. It also helps in the preservation of the cream.

Wafer Sheet

The wafer sheet contains about 41 % of cheese wafer. Let’s now see about the ingredients used for the production of the wafer sheet.

Nabati Wafer ingredients 6

Source : Wheat grain
How : Wheat bran is separated from the wheat grain during the milling process. Then the starchy white part of the wheat grain is grounded to produce refined wheat flour.
Why : Refined wheat flour acts as a base ingredient for the production of the wafer sheet, and also gives texture to the wafer sheet.

  • Palm Olein

Source : Palm fruit
How : Palm olein is obtained by extracting palm oil from reddish pulp of a palm fruit. This obtained palm oil contains about fifty percent saturated and fifty percent unsaturated fat content. In which, the unsaturated fat is separated using fractional distillation methods to produce palm olein oil.
Why : Palm olein acts as a texture improver, provides crispiness and also acts as a lubricant during the production of wafer sheet.

Ingredients to Know Before Buying

Nabati Cheese Wafer consists of about 10.73 g of sugar in 37 g whole pack. If you are concerned about sugar intake in your diet, this is a valuable info.

Nabati Cheese Wafer contains artificial colours, which some people can be sensitive or intolerant. If you are allergic towards artificial colours do monitor the intake.

Nutritional Info and Sugar Info! We can see single * in nutritional info and a double * in sugar, why?
Nutritional information per 100 g of the product is given by NIN. NIN is the National Institute of Nutrition. It is under ICMR (Indian Council of Medical Research)
But, the sugar information in the nutritional list is given by the US FDA (Food and Drug Administration) norm. Here sugar represents the ingredients that also contain sugar like corn starch, maltodextrin etc. during the process.

Some Interesting Facts Before You Leave

Fact 1
The meaning of Nabati is an Arabic adjective that means plant based. Nabati serves only vegetarian and vegan food products.
FACT 2
Richeese factory is owned by Nabati. It is a fast food restaurant that almost serves food with cheese sauce.
Fact 3
Richeese Nabati got Indonesia best brand award and Indonesia best packaging award in 2009.
